Manchester United boss Erik ten Hag is still backing his side to bounce back after a second crushing defeat in 3 days.

Erik ten Hag saw his Manchester United side lose 3-0 to a rampant Newcastle on Wednesday night in the Carabao Cup. 

Questions are now being asked about the manager's long-term future and the direction of the team moving forward. 

Despite the consecutive defeats, Ten Hag insists he is a “fighter” and possesses the confidence to reverse Manchester United’s fortunes.

Ten Hag on Man Utd's bad form

So I am a fighter and I know it is not always going to go up and we have a lot of setbacks this season,” said the Dutchman. “But also you have to deal with it and that is never an excuse.

“I understand it when the results are not there it is also a logical process that they are questioning that. But I am confident I can do it. 

Erik ten Hag

"At all my clubs I have done it and also last year here I did it as well, but at this moment we are in a bad place. I take responsibility for it. 

“I see it as a challenge. I am a fighter and I am in that fight and I have to make sure that I share the responsibility with my players and that we stick together and fight together, and get better results.
